LEADERSHIP BRIEFING — Sales Leads

Topic: Proposed joint venture with Quillbrook Systems

Heads up: we're exploring a JV with Quillbrook to co-sell the Marrowell platform in the northern territories. Terms are early-stage — don't mention it to accounts yet. If it lands, quotas shift in Q2. Background on how this fits our plans is appended below.

board note of kagep-yahig: Only 9 of the 120 pilot accounts renewed Quenix, so a churn review is set for April 1.

The nightly pipeline for the SproutCycle plant-watering scheduler began failing after we pinned the moisture-model fixtures. Investigation shows the sandbox runner caches an older valve-timing table, so integration tests compare against stale thresholds. No credentials are exposed; the failure is purely a cache-invalidation ordering issue. We cleared the runner cache, re-ran the suite twice, and confirmed deterministic green builds. For audit purposes, the verified rerun is recorded under the token below.

session token of taduf-tahog = htk4_91a1

Liftwright runs the elevator-dispatch simulation for the Marrowgate tower models. Two service accounts exist: sim-runner (executes scenario batches) and sim-reporter (read-only metrics export). Neither has interactive login. Scopes are pinned per environment; prod grants are audited quarterly. sim-runner authenticates to the internal Dispatchd API over mTLS plus a static key, rotated every 90 days by the Wardkeeper job. No shared human use permitted. The current sim-runner key for the review environment follows.

gateway credential: kto3_qfe

## Runbook: Dribbletide scheduler restart

Dribbletide drives valve timers for all greenhouse zones. If watering cycles stall, check the cron shard first; a stuck shard blocks every downstream zone. Restart the scheduler pod, then confirm the next three cycles fire within tolerance. Do not restart during an active watering window — valves can stick open. Manual overrides live in the ops console and expire after one hour. The values the scheduler boots with are listed below.

service settings:
[briius]
port = 3000
region = outer-1
host = briius.zarqeldyn.internal
team = wenael
timeout_ms = 2000
retries = 5